Warning Signs You Need Wall Water Damage Repair

Catching water damage early saves you money and prevents b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of mold or mildew growth within your walls. Don’t ignore this warning sign, it’s a sign that something’s amiss.

Water Stains on Your Ceilings or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a leak or flood, and they should be addressed immediately to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, and it should be repaired or replaced as soon as possible to prevent further damage.

Increased Humidity and Moisture

High humidity and moisture levels can be a sign of water damage, and they should be addressed immediately to prevent further damage.

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ew

Visible signs of mold or mildew, such as black spots or greenish growth, should be addressed immediately to prevent further damage and health risks.

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ak under 10 square feet Yes No DIY is fine for small leaks under 10 square feet, but call a pro for anything larger.
Major flood or water damage No Yes Major floods or water damage need the expertise of a professional to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ough repair.
Mold or mildew growth No Yes Mold or mildew grow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ely and effectively.
Water damage behind walls or floors No Yes Hidden water damage behind walls or floors need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air.
Water damage with structural damage No Yes Water damage with structural damage needs the expertise of a professional to ensure a safe and secure repair.
